UPDATE: here is the recap of the advices i received so far :

First : I should check if have remote for service menu then check the hour counter!

About models pictured :

- JVC : interi ar/Musset = l'art but maybe more ancient model ?

- 2: JVC may have component
- 3 : component input, maybe be aslo KV-AR like 13
- 4 : KV-DR Digital DRC
- 5, 10, 15 : maybe a sony KV-29CL10B, or KV-HW21 or SW292M : have component, date between XF and AR ?
- 6: JVC F series= maybe same than D-serie?
- 7 : maybe an European Trinitron KV-BM21: no component
- 8 : some say have digital , some says not (AR or DR?) not sure yet
- 11: old Trinitron with no component, maybe a XF model with only S video input
- 13: SD crt for sure, maybe the best bet, KV-AR21 (more like 27 or 29) : good sound and component input
- 12, 14 : most recent JVC which has been recommended twice but could have DRC, need to check manual


KV-XF/AR large size can be RGB modded, but not 21 inch BM/HW/AR (BX1S chassis)
KV-AR21/29M (3 and 13) seems the most recent model, i might go for one of these two
